答案:使用 Java 框架優化高並發場景的效能。具體方法:使用流行的 Java 框架,如 Spring Boot、Vert.x、Reactor、Akka。實作非同步服務層,並行處理請求。配置自訂線程池,優化並發線程數。整合緩存機制,減少資料庫查詢。
透過使用Java 框架來最佳化高並發場景的效能
##引言
在高並發環境中,管理大量的並發請求至關重要,因為這會影響應用程式的穩定性和回應時間。為了應對這項挑戰,開發人員可以使用 Java 框架來優化應用程式的效能。流行的Java 框架
優化高並發場景的流行Java 框架包括:#實踐案例:使用Spring Boot 優化e-commerce 網站
#以一個e -commerce 網站為例,其處理大量的請求。在高峰時段,網站必須能夠同時處理來自多個用戶的大量訂單。 為了優化此網站的效能,我們可以使用 Spring Boot。 Spring Boot 的自動設定功能簡化了應用程式的設置,並提供了用於處理並發的開箱即用元件。具體實作
註解,透過 REST API 提供產品和訂單功能。
註解,以便應用程式可以並行處理訂單處理請求。
配置自訂的執行緒池,以最佳化處理請求的並發執行緒數。
結果
透過實作這些最佳化措施,e-commerce 網站能夠在高並發場景下顯著提高效能。訂單處理時間縮短,網站回應時間更短,對使用者體驗和銷售轉換率都有好處。結論
使用 Java 框架可以顯著增強高並發場景中的應用程式效能。透過利用非同步處理、線程池優化和快取機制,開發人員可以建立可擴展且響應迅速的應用程式。以上是針對高並發場景優化的Java框架效能的詳細內容。更多資訊請關注PHP中文網其他相關文章!